Award Nominations

I'm absolutely thrilled to share with you that three of my books have been nominated for three different awards. 

The Pennsylvania School Library Association has nominated Whooo Knew? The Truth About Owls for the Pennsylvania Young Reader's Choice Award for 2022-2023.

The Washington Library Association has nominated Scurry! The Truth About Spiders for the 2023 Towner Award

The Keystone State Literacy Association has nominated Woof! The Truth About Dogs for the 2022-2023 Keystone to Reading Award.
Each of these nominations is a true honor, especially when I see the incredible other book nominations on the lists. I'm thrilled teachers and librarians have nominated my books for students to determine the winner of the awards.  

The nominated titles are the first three STEM books in The Truth About series from Reycraft Books. They're packed with facts and use a question-and-answer structure. Stunning photography and Juanbjuan Oliver's humorous illustrations fill each page spread. Each book also includes plenty of back matter so readers can learn even more about the animals.
